Transaction 0781789e811fd3baef09ea6c6834bf39d0885fa958766ef931b9115aa8c90845
1 Input
2 Outputs
- 0781789e811fd3baef09ea6c6834bf39d0885fa958766ef931b9115aa8c90845:0
- 0781789e811fd3baef09ea6c6834bf39d0885fa958766ef931b9115aa8c90845:1
value 2368000000
address 33YmGEEv2hLPBYUDLtF5aoVjJTKRyjXRnH
value 28002931500
address 31q2vcFC5fJbCiVtGikJN2fLx9eXi75hDW